Extreme efficiency can be very disruptive. I have a solar system in my place in the Cayman Islands, which supplies some of my electricity.

From the Pareto Principle principle, I know that 80% of my power consumption comes from 20% of my house.

The air conditioning and pool pump are the things that consume electricity.

Now you'd think let's go and use traditional integration techniques to grab the relevant data and make it work.

Nah.

That's really expensive and would involve tricky electronics, costs, and risk.

That's not the Theory of Constraints way. Instead, let's do it much less expensively.

We can just use cheap little computers called Raspberry Pis. These run Linux have an ARM processor. We can hook up cheap video cameras to them and just point them at the relevant systems and use a bit of scripting with Lua - ala Flow Device and there you have it: a 'good enough' integration that hasn't cost $100,000 in order to get cost savings of $500 for 16 years (knowing full well that the gear will have stopped working by then).

Now if I do it for my house and create an inexpensive 'recipe' for the rest of the island, which I give away as open source and have Caymanian affiliates go and do the actual work - thus saving me a whole load of paperwork. Then everyone's happy, saving a bunch of money on power (and water).
